Are tandem bikes good exercise?
Tandems are more efficient than single bikes, at least on flat ground (you get the same amount of wind resistance, but have two people peddling). Even though I am slower than my husband on my own, together we are faster than he is alone. We both contribute, and we both get a good workout.

Is tandem cycling in the Olympics?
Tandem Cycling at the Olympics Tandem cycling was a men’s only two rider team event that was a part of the intercalated games in 1906 and a part of the Olympics in 1908 and a period from 1920 to 1972. Tandem cycling has not completely disappeared, now you will see tandem events as part of the Paralymics.
Can a visually impaired person ride a bike?
The way in which visually impaired cycling works is that a blind or visually impaired person goes on a tandem with a sighted person, the sighted person is obviously at the front and the blind person at the back. The bike rides are all done on cycle paths or quiet country roads, so it is safe.
Do both riders have to pedal on a tandem bike?
Riding a tandem requires teamwork, though. The front rider (captain) does all the steering and braking, which means earning and keeping the trust of the rear rider (stoker). For most tandem bikes, the riders must pedal in synch at the same rate, which means compromise.
Can 1 person ride a tandem bike?
Originally Answered: Can a tandem bike be ridden by one person? As long as that one person comfortably fits in the bike’s “cockpit” (the seat, typically in front, from which steering and braking are accomplished), it is possible for one person to ride a tandem bicycle.
